Sourcing guidance for Wholesale Gas Flare
What are the key technical specifications to consider when sourcing industrial gas flares?
Buyers must prioritize combustion efficiency (typically >98%) to ensure complete destruction of hydrocarbons. Key components include the flare tip, which should be made of heat-resistant alloys like Incoloy 800H or 310 Stainless Steel to withstand extreme temperatures. Additionally, evaluate the pilot ignition system (electronic or flame front generator) for reliability in adverse weather conditions, and ensure the gas flow rate (SCFH) matches your specific industrial output.
Which international compliance standards are mandatory for gas flare systems?
For global trade, equipment must adhere to API 521 (Pressure-relieving and Depressuring Systems) and API 537 (Flare Details for General Refinery and Petrochemical Service). If exporting to the EU, CE marking and ATEX certification for explosive atmospheres are required. For the US market, compliance with EPA 40 CFR 60.18 regarding smokeless operation and exit velocity is essential to avoid heavy environmental fines.
How do I choose between an open flare and an enclosed ground flare (EGF)?
The choice depends on the usage scenario and environmental regulations. Open flares are cost-effective for high-volume emergency relief but produce visible light and noise. Enclosed Ground Flares (EGF) are superior for urban or environmentally sensitive areas as they hide the flame, reduce noise pollution, and allow for better emission monitoring, though they carry a higher initial capital expenditure (CAPEX).
What safety features are critical for preventing operational hazards?
A high-quality gas flare must include a liquid seal drum or molecular seal to prevent flashback into the header pipe. Furthermore, integrated flame sensors (UV/IR detectors) are vital for real-time monitoring. Ensure the system has an automated emergency shutdown (ESD) capability and a robust knock-out drum to remove liquid droplets from the gas stream before combustion.
Cross-Border Procurement & Risk Management for Gas Flares
What are the primary risks when purchasing heavy industrial equipment like gas flares internationally?
The main risks include logistical damage to refractory linings and non-compliance with local environmental laws. How should I negotiate with suppliers regarding customization and technical support?
Focus on the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for the inclusion of critical spare parts for 2 years of operation and request FAT (Factory Acceptance Testing) video documentation. Ensure the contract specifies remote technical commissioning support or on-site supervision for the installation phase.
What are the best practices for shipping and logistics for oversized flare stacks?
Gas flares are often Out-of-Gauge (OOG) cargo. You should utilize Breakbulk shipping or Flat Rack containers. Ensure the supplier uses seaworthy packaging with VCI (Volatile Corrosion Inhibitor) film to prevent salt-air corrosion during transit. Clearly define Incoterms (e.g., DAP or CIF) to establish exactly where the risk transfers from the seller to the buyer.
